It's all about tolerance stacking with 50 year old parts
if valves are sunk pushrod theoretically shortens by 2/3
larger valves and higher seats just the opposite
just put it together and see if there is some play when you push the pushrod down
not a race car or fast action cam you are good to go
then cut the tops off a couple of old valve covers and observe lifter rotation and oiling,
you can do the oiling check when you spin the oil pump with a drill IF you have the oil holes in the cam lined up - rotate the crank slowly with a breaker bar and observe- remember cam is at half speed of crank so you might have to go around twice to hit oil- if you do not hit oil then find out why before you fire the motor
